Problem

Conventional methods for monitoring brand performance are data source and economically centric, failing to provide a holistic view that incorporates investment or expenditure factors, requiring separate monitoring of performance and return on investment for each data source/service provider.

Innovation Solution

A system and method that dynamically pulls organic data from multiple online sources, scores brand performance in real-time against competitors using a weighted formulation, incorporating both influence and exposure factors to calculate a brand's mass attraction score, allowing for a holistic view of market performance and investment impact.

AI summary

An interactive algorithm and sequential methodology dynamically that pulls numerous organic data sets from online social, search, sentiment and paid media sources against a weighted formulation to determine with statistical significance a brand's market performance and characterization defined as a “Brand Attraction Score” in real time against key competitors. Consumer and media behaviors are measured using billions of data signals from multiple API sources distributed downstream through a series of influence (I) and exposure (E) weighted formulations to a master algorithm to determine the net performance and attraction scores and ranking. These statistical sets are then conformed into a series of scores and rankings in a predetermined competitive set in an Exposure to Attraction coordinate system, thereby allowing a Brand to easily visualize their comparative Attraction among their competitor brands.
